Evolve — Total Self-Modification
Every layer of you is rewritable by writing files to .mimocode/ (reload semantics differ per layer — see File Locations):
- What you can do — create tools, or override any built-in (bash, read, edit, ...) with your own implementation
- How you behave — hooks intercept everything: every tool call (block/rewrite args/rewrite output), every LLM request (system prompt, message list, temperature, headers), every session and subagent lifecycle event (cancel a run before it starts, gate a subagent's delivery and force it to redo work, inspect full trajectories after each step)
- What you know — skills persist domain knowledge across sessions
- How you orchestrate — workflow scripts encode multi-agent pipelines deterministically
- What the user sees — TUI plugins add panels, commands, dialogs, routes to the interface itself
This skill is not documentation — it is a standing instruction to notice when you should evolve, and act on it.
When to evolve (triggers)
Act on these signals — don't wait for the user to ask:
| Signal | Action |
|---|---|
| You ran the same bash/API sequence 3+ times (this or past sessions) | Wrap it into a tool |
| You keep making the same mistake, or the user keeps correcting the same behavior | Add a hook to block/fix it structurally |
| You learned non-obvious project knowledge that future sessions will need | Write a skill to persist it |
| A built-in tool's behavior conflicts with project needs | Override it (same-name tool) |
| A workflow you hand-orchestrated worked well and may repeat | Save it as a workflow script |
Before creating: check whether the extension already exists (ls .mimocode/tools .mimocode/hooks .mimocode/skills). Prefer improving an existing one over adding a near-duplicate.
Decision flow
Need to change WHAT you can do → tool (new capability, wraps commands/APIs)
Need to change HOW you behave → hook (intercept/modify/block existing behavior)
Need to remember HOW to do X → skill (knowledge, loaded on demand)
Need to redo a multi-agent run → workflow (.mimocode/workflows/*.js)
Need to change the UI → TUI plugin (.mimocode/tui/*.tsx)

evolve is a skill published in the GitHub repository XiaomiMiMo/MiMo-Code (12,904 stars, last pushed 2d ago), licensed MIT. It costs nothing until one of its globs matches a file; then it loads 1,627 tokens. A static security scan graded it C with 1 finding (recursive force delete).
